Tabor City Police Department, North Carolina
End of Watch Saturday, May 15, 2004
Add to My HeroesShane Miller
Patrolman Shane Miller was killed in an automobile crash during a vehicle pursuit on his first shift as an officer with the Tabor City Police Department.
At 1:00n a.m., Patrolman Miller was a passenger in the patrol car that was pursuing a vehicle on N.C. 904 when it collided head-on with another vehicle as they attempted to pass a slow-moving car. Patrolman Miller sustained fatal injuries in the collision. The driver of the patrol car and the occupants of the other vehicle were also injured.
The driver of the vehicle being chased was apprehended. He was convicted of charges relating to the incident and was sentenced to 6 months in jail and 3 years' probation in March 2005.
Patrolman Miller had been sworn in as an officer on Friday and started his first shift that evening. He had previously served as a corrections officer for the North Carolina Department of Corrections for 7 years. He is survived by his parents.
In 2024, Complex Street in Tabor City was dedicated to his memory.
